At 10:53 AM -0700 9/22/01, Andrew Daviel wrote:
>When running htDig, 3.2.0b4 snapshot I think, on Linux, I got an
>error message "DB_RUNRECOVERY: Fatal error, run database recovery"
BTW, you don't mention which snapshot you're using, and of course
there are snapshots made every week so it's not that useful to say "a
snapshot of 3.2.0b4."
I would assume it's referring to the db_recover utility for the
Berkeley database. However, this won't be much use since Berkeley
doesn't seem to be interested in the compressed database code that
has been implemented for mifluz/ht://Dig.
>Is there any way to recover, apart from just starting over maybe seeded
>with allurl.list or something ?
I would try the utilities in the htdb/ directory when you compile,
though I suspect these may not help that much either.
>Is there any way to guard against database errors, or debug them, apart
>from maybe keeping diffferent database versions ?
Well, you haven't given us much information as far as debugging. What
version of Linux are you using? What compiler, libc, etc.? What
snapshot was this? Have you tried the latest snapshot? How many
documents do you have in your database? These sorts of questions help
a lot as far as tracking things down. Certainly, if the db_recover
utility does something useful, that would be nice to know.
--
--
-Geoff Hutchison
Williams Students Online
http://wso.williams.edu/
_______________________________________________
htdig-general mailing list <[EMAIL PROTECTED]>
To unsubscribe, send a message to <[EMAIL PROTECTED]> with a
subject of unsubscribe
FAQ: http://htdig.sourceforge.net/FAQ.html